Stored measurements can be visualized and edited from the Measurements list.
-
Open Job tab.
-
Select Points/Measurements/Codes.
-
Open the Measurements tab. The page lists the measurements.
-
Tap on a point and select Edit.
-
The data of the point is organised in pages.
Point page
-
Point page include coordinate information of measured point.
-
Point: name of the point.
-
Rover antenna height: GNSS antenna elevation. When the antenna elevation is changed, the corresponding point coordinates are recalculated.
-
Tilt: in case of use of GNSS receivers with IMU, this field displays the GNSS pole tilt.
-
Target height: TPS target elevation. When the antenna elevation is changed, the corresponding point coordinates are recalculated.
-
Date/Time: date and time when the measurement has been performed.
-
E, N, Z: plane coordinates of the point.
-
Depth: in case of measure with a vertical offset, the depth shows the vertical offset.
-
Geodetic coords: allows to choose the format for the WGS84 coordinate.
-
Latitude, longitude and height: the coordinate is visualized as latitude, longitude and height.
-
ECEF XYZ: the coordinate is visualized as earth centered coordinate.
-

Code page
-
The Code & Description page displays measurement properties such as code, description, and GIS features.
-
Code: survey code of the point. Click > to open the codes library and select a different code from the list.
-
Description: extended description of the point.
-
Date: date and time when the point was stored.
-
GIS Data: if GIS features have been associated to the point click Edit to enter or modify the corresponding GIS attributes.

Measurement page (TPS only)
-
Measurement page shows the properties of the total station measure.
-
Horizontal angle: the measured horizontal angle.
-
Vertical angle: the measured vertical angle.
-
Slope distance: the measured slope distance.
-
Horizontal distance: the measured horizontal distance.
-
Vertical distance: the measured vertical distance.
-
Target type: the type of target used in the measure. Click on the arrow to change the target type used: this operation recalculates the point coordinate.
-
PPM (cartographic): the combined scale factor for ground to grid reduction used for the measure.
-
PPM (atmospheric): the atmospheric scale factor used for the measure.
-
Prism aim mode: the mode used to aim the target.

Quality page (GNSS only)
-
Quality page shows information about the quality of the GNSS measurement.
-
Quality: the quality of the GNSS positioning (RTK fixed, Mobile, Autonomous)
-
Precision: the estimated positioning error in planimetry and elevation.
-
PDOP: the calculated PDOP (positional dilution of precision).
-
GDOP: the calculated GDOP (geometric dilution of precision)
-
Satellites: the used satellites. The number of satellites is subdivided by GNSS constellation (GPS, GLONASS, Beidou, Galileo).
-
Epochs: the number of epochs.
-
Tilt: in case of measure with IMU receiver, this field shows the pole tilt in degrees.

Atmospheric corrections (TPS only)
-
The Atmospheric corrections page is available for TPS station setup. The page shows the atmospheric corrections used for the measurements from this station and the refraction and sphericity parameters.
-
Atmospheric correction: shows if atmospheric corrections was used.
-
Temperature (°C): the temperature value in degrees Celsius.
-
Pressure (mb): the pressure value in millibar.
-
Humidity (%): the humidity value in percent.
-
Atmospheric PPM: the calculated PPM considering all parameters.
-
Refraction and sphericity: shows if refraction and sphericity parameters was used.
-
Refraction coeff.: value for the refraction.
